Output 1dc69bcaafc13a06bfa0189483f19b914e3f2fab506fbcd19104679b32bf3d74:2

value
650881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70fe8c71b48898e188dcd5634ee92aa1e1765561 OP_EQUAL
address
3BzUYNmwqfNKYj54eUUuKEJFbnn6aftBZV
transaction
1dc69bcaafc13a06bfa0189483f19b914e3f2fab506fbcd19104679b32bf3d74
confirmations
351241
spent
true